Merge branch 'zf/maint-gitweb-acname'
[gitweb.git] / t / t6010-merge-base.sh
index 79124ec761a90fd0e2f028b4566fd21947ba5490..0144d9e858d2d8bf1720331c52f1809ed36e81b0 100755 (executable)
@@ -149,6 +149,12 @@ test_expect_success 'merge-base A B C' '
        test "$MM1" = "$MB"
 '
 
+test_expect_success 'merge-base A B C using show-branch' '
+       MB=$(git show-branch --merge-base MMA MMB MMC) &&
+       MMR=$(git rev-parse --verify MMR) &&
+       test "$MMR" = "$MB"
+'
+
 test_expect_success 'criss-cross merge-base for octopus-step (setup)' '
        git reset --hard MMR &&
        test_tick && git commit --allow-empty -m 1 && git tag CC1 &&